1800, Digest of the laws of the State of Georgia
1800 Digest of the laws of the State of Georgia. Included were an appendix concerning various boundary issues, an index, a list of subscribers, and
a listing of errata from the Secretary's Office. (Digitized from a microfilm copy of title originally held by the Library of Congress).
Title:   A digest of the laws of the State of Georgia : from its first establishment as a British province down to the year 1798, inclusive, and the principal acts of 1799 : in which is comprehended the Declaration of Independence : the state constitutions of 1777 and 1789, with the alterations and amendments in 1794 : also the Constitution of 1798 : it contains as well all the laws in force, as those which are deemed useful and necessary, or which are explanatory of existing laws ; together, with the titles of all the obsolete and other acts : and concludes with an appendix containing the original charters and other documents, ascertaining and defining the limits and boundary of the state : all the treaties with the southern tribes of Indians : the Articles of Confederation and perpetual union : the Constitution of the United States, and a few acts of Congress : together with a copious index to the whole / by Robert & George Watkins.
